Redesigning the Pitch Deck: Telling a Clear Story

The first step in our partnership with Trusto was to tackle their pitch deck. The pitch deck is often the first point of contact with investors, making it crucial to present the product in a way that’s visually appealing and easy to digest.

Logical Structure
We restructured the presentation to tell a cohesive story, taking investors through the journey from the problem of chargebacks to the solution Trusto offers. Each slide was carefully crafted to address potential questions investors might have, with clear, concise messaging.

Data Visualization
We understood the importance of data to investors, so we focused on visualizing key numbers and statistics that showed Trusto’s potential impact. Using charts, graphs, and infographics, we highlighted the business savings and the reduction in chargebacks that Trusto’s platform offers.

Typography and Color Choices
To establish credibility and trust, we selected fonts with high contrast and a color palette of deep blues and light shades. This combination created a sense of professionalism, technology, and reliability.

Custom Visuals
Rather than relying on stock images, we designed unique icons and process diagrams to explain how Trusto works. These custom visuals helped simplify complex concepts, making them more accessible to investors and other stakeholders.

Result
The pitch deck became a powerful tool for Trusto, not only informing potential investors but also persuading them of the product’s value.

Building the Website: From Concept to Clarity

After successfully revamping the pitch deck, we turned our attention to Trusto’s website — the public face of the company. The goal was to ensure that the website was as clear and engaging as the pitch deck, providing potential clients with an intuitive and informative experience.

Clear Structure
We designed the homepage to immediately answer the three most important questions: What is Trusto? How does it work? What’s in it for the user? With a concise value proposition on the main screen and visualized key benefits below, we made sure visitors knew exactly what Trusto offered in just a few seconds.

Simplified Illustrations and Diagrams
To explain how Trusto’s platform works, we broke down the process into simple, easy-to-understand diagrams. We used a step-by-step approach to guide users through the chargeback prevention journey. Even non-technical visitors could easily grasp how Trusto could benefit their business.

Micro-Animations
To make the website more dynamic and engaging, we added micro-animations throughout the site. For example, in the “How It Works” section, we used animations to showcase the prevention of chargebacks, making the site feel more interactive and alive.

Minimalist Design
In keeping with Trusto’s brand, we chose a minimalist design approach. We focused on making the content the star of the show, with subtle gradients and small accents to enhance the site’s technological feel.

Result
The website became a valuable asset for Trusto, clearly conveying the platform’s benefits while engaging visitors with its modern design. The intuitive navigation and clear content made it easy for potential clients to understand what Trusto could offer, increasing the likelihood of conversion.

Building Trust: Establishing Credibility Through Transparency

At the time of development, Trusto didn’t have real case studies or customer reviews to showcase, so we focused on building trust in other ways.

Transparency
We created sections on the website that explained Trusto’s features and benefits in detail. We also included data comparisons to competitors, emphasizing Trusto’s unique advantages.

Competitor Comparison
Through clear visualizations and text, we showcased how Trusto stood out from the competition, further building trust with potential clients by emphasizing the platform’s unique value proposition.

Minimalist Yet Warm Style
The design was professional and tech-focused, but we ensured it didn’t feel too cold or distant. A minimalist, yet inviting style helped make Trusto seem approachable while still maintaining a sense of expertise.

Testing for Perfection
We tested several iterations of the homepage to find the best balance between messaging, value propositions, and visual focus. This iterative process helped us create a page that maximized clarity while drawing in users.
